What is Mesothelioma?
Mesothelioma is a type of cancer that affects the mesothelium. It is the lining of the membrane or lining that surrounds certain organs of the body. Mesothelioma can be caused by cancerous cells within the lining of the mesothelium. People who have been exposed to asbestos could develop this rare type of cancer.
Asbestos is an assortment of minerals that contain thin fibers. It was used in many ways, such as insulation, fire retardant, in manufacturing and construction. The most frequent exposure to asbestos occurs in the workplace such as construction as well as the U.S. Navy, and mining. Workers in these industries are at greater risk of exposure to mesothelioma.
The diagnosis of mesothelioma can be complex and requires a variety of tests. A doctor may measure the presence of fluid in the abdomen or chest or take mesothelium to be examined under microscope. Doctors can diagnose mesothelioma on the results. A biopsy is typically the only way to confirm mesothelioma.

How Does Asbestos Lead to Mesothelioma?
Asbestos occurs naturally and is often found with talc. Because the two minerals have similar geological structures, a lot of asbestos-related workers were also exposed to talcum powder. Therefore, if talcum was made using raw materials that contained asbestos, it may have put people who were exposed to the product at risk of mesothelioma. The exposure to asbestos can be experienced in a variety of different ways. For example, asbestos-contaminated talcum powder could have been used in asbestos-reinforced cosmetics and personal hygiene products such as mascara, lipstick, foundation and deodorant.
In addition, employees in the manufacturing and mining industries may have been exposed to talcum powder contaminated with asbestos due to the fact that it was commonly used in industrial formulations. Workers who handled these products containing talcum powder could take the dust home with them on their clothing and shoes and potentially expose family members to asbestos.
Women who use talcum powder for feminine hygiene are at a higher chance of developing mesothelioma as the dust can enter genital areas and cause cancer. The asbestos-contaminated talcum powder can also be inhaled, which can lead to pleural mesothelioma.
Mesothelioma signs typically take a long time to show up, which means those who have been exposed to talcum powder containing asbestos for long periods of time are at greater risk. The type of mesothelioma a person has determines their symptoms and prognosis. Pleural mesothelioma is a type of cancer that can cause chest discomfort, coughing and trouble breathing. Peritoneal mesothelioma is often associated with abdominal swelling, pain, and distension. Pericardial Mesothelioma can trigger symptoms such as heart murmurs and heart palpitations.

In the past few months, two juries in different states handed down substantial verdicts in talcum-based mesothelioma lawsuits against Johnson & Johnson. In one case the jury gave $18.1 million to the family of a woman who passed away from mesothelioma that was caused by asbestos in J&J talcum powder products. In a second talcum-powder mesothelioma case the jury awarded $29,000,000 to the plaintiff's wrongful death lawsuit.
In the month of March, a third mesothelioma lawsuit involving talcum powder against J&J will be argued. The woman's lawyers claim that she developed mesothelioma from using J&J talcum powder to cleanse her vagina over a span of many years. The lawsuit claims that J&J did not warn consumers about the dangers of mesothelioma caused by talcum powder, resulting in her illness and wrongful death.
As of late, seven cases of cancer involving talcum powder have been added to the multidistrict litigation (MDL) against Johnson & Johnson. The MDL includes more than 16,000 claims from women who were diagnosed as having cancer of the ovary after the use of talcum powder manufactured by J&J.
The MDL was established after a judge decided that J&J's baby products and other products containing talcum powder were linked to cancer of the ovary in several cases. The company has denied the allegations, however testing of old bottles of J&J powders from homes of people and even from the J&J corporate headquarters has shown that these products could be contaminated with asbestos that is dangerous.

Plaintiffs claim that J&J was aware of asbestos-related hazards in its talcum powder and other talcum products but did not inform consumers. They claim that J&J also concealed asbestos test results and conducted flawed testing.
Johnson & Johnson faces numerous lawsuits from women who have developed cancer of the ovary as a result of the use of its talcum products. They believe that Johnson & Johnson was aware of the connection between the talcum powder and cancer of the ovary for decades, but continued to market its talcum powder as safe.
The talcum powder lawsuits against Johnson & Johnson allege that asbestos is present in the talc which is mined to be used in J&J's Baby Powder and Shower to Shower products. The talcum powder is used on the genitals and may be inhaled, which could cause asbestos fibers to be trapped in the lungs. These asbestos fibers can cause a variety of serious illnesses, including mesothelioma, ovarian cancer, and lung fibrosis.
